Who We Are Looking For:

We’re looking for an Architectural Designer with 3-6 years of experience to support the conceptual development and creation of drawings and design materials for a diverse range of public assembly building types including sports venues, convention centers, community buildings and transportation facilities.

What Your Day Could Consist Of:
  • Supporting the development of design solutions from master planning and concept design through to construction documents.
  • Assisting in the creation of conceptual drawings, diagrams, digital models and visual imagery to support design ideas.
  • Producing diagrams, digital models, and other production materials according to industry standards and technical requirements.
  • Contributing to the preparation of construction details in accordance with project specifications.
  • Preparing presentation materials and contributing to project interviews and design presentations.
  • Participating in collaborative critiques to help refine early-phase design concepts.
  • Under the guidance of experienced designers and consultants, assisting in coordinating project documents and models.
  • Conducting research on precedents, materials and design solutions to inform project development and enhance project outcomes.
Requirements For Success:
  • Proven skill in creative and innovative design thinking, collaborative problem-solving, architectural production, spatial and environmental design, story development and delivering exceptional design solutions.
  • Understanding of architectural design and construction principles, with a willingness to grow knowledge of industry standards and regulations.
  • Outstanding verbal and written communication skills with the ability to clearly and accurately share design ideas.
  • Strong sketching and freehand drawing skills, capable of producing quick and impactful sketches to effectively communicate and sell design concepts.
  • Familiarity with Revit, Bluebeam and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ign).
  • Working knowledge of 3D modeling software such as 3DS Max, Sketch Up and Maxwell Render.
  • Highly self-motivated and capable of thriving in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
  • Ability to work effectively both independently and within a collaborative team.
